What Do Carpenter Ants Do to Wooden Materials?

Like termites, carpenter ants are notorious for causing structural damage on wood structures which is why most people assume that these ants eat wood. The truth is carpenter ants don’t eat wood; indoors, their diet consists mainly of proteins such as pet food, sweets and meats. Outdoors they mainly feed on small insects. Here at…
